Coached by Monica Wagner and featuring (from left) Ross Richardson, Sarah Mayo, Rachel Lawson, Benton Turner, Nick Arnett and Ryan Kanning, the interdisciplinary team from Lutheran High School has qualified for Saturday’s state finals of the Academic Super Bowl at Purdue. Their areas of expertise are English, math, science, social studies and fine arts.
The math team of Joey Wilkins, Forty Suptaveepipat, Sara Kadono, Jake Watkins, Turner and Kanning and the English squad of Dionte McFadden, Nina Milivojac, Drew Settlemyre, Arnett and Mayo placed second in their divisions during the qualifying rounds.
The fine arts duo of Faith Shilkett and Lawson placed first; the science team of Branden Adams, Jackson Waite and Turner placed third; and the social studies sextet of Jake Kent, Blake Sobieralski, Quentin Brown, Travis Frist, Ross Richardson and Tyler Reed finished fourth.
